Torricelli admonished by Senate
CNN
| 7/30/2002
| Jonathan Karl
Posted on 07/30/2002 4:25:34 PM PDT by sinkspur
Senator Robert Torricelli has been admonished by the Senate Ethics Committee in a letter sent to him late this afternoon. He has been ordered to repay the donor who sent him gifts.
